Welcome to the Ledgerpoint payments team. One recurring topic at the weekly eng sync is our flaky integration suite, particularly the settlement tests that intermittently fail against the Bramblefield sandbox. Before retrying a red build, check whether the sandbox tenant has been reset — most flakes trace back to stale tenant state rather than real regressions. Resetting the tenant requires elevated access to the sandbox vault, and the reset tool will prompt you for the recovery passphrase, reproduced here:

recovery phrase for fajeg-hagug: holox-fenmir

Subject: Flaky integration tests on Tollgate payments — update

Hey all — quick note before the sync. The Tollgate integration suite has been flaking about one run in five, mostly on the refund-retry cases. It looks like a race between the sandbox ledger reset and the first test's setup, not a real payments bug. We've added a readiness check and will watch it this week. For reference, the last clean run carries the token below.

pipeline stamp: htk9_ce63042d9

**16:40** — Dark mode rolled out to the Owlbridge admin dashboard and, well, a few panels didn't get the memo. Support saw reports of white-on-white text in the refunds view. We flipped the feature flag off at 16:55 and things went back to normal. If a customer mentions invisible text, that's this. The dashboard build that caused it is listed below for your reference.

trace token, fafog-kageg: htk4_98e6

Release checklist — Velvetina Stagehall seat-map renderer. Confirm the Orchestra and Balcony tiers render accessible-seat icons at all zoom levels, and that held seats grey out within two seconds of a box-office lock. Support should verify the fallback list view loads when WebGL is unavailable. Once these checks pass, record the renderer build token shown below in the release log.

session token of tajef-bageg = htk21_5d90d574934f3ccae6437

**Key ceremony checklist — item 4 (Quorble migration)**

Before we swap the homegrown job queue for Quorble next sprint, we need to rotate the signing key that the old dispatcher uses. Marit and Dov will run the ceremony Thursday after the sync. Please don't kick off any bulk jobs that afternoon — the queue will drain slowly and that's fine. Once the new key is sealed, the recovery passphrase goes right below this line.

unlock words, yawig-kagef: gordor-holvan-ulaael-pramir-ulaiel-tamdor